How many consulates China has in us?
The people’s Republic of China currently maintains one Embassy in Washington D.C., but also maintains 5 consulates-general in the following U.S. cities: New York, NY; Chicago, IL; San Francisco, CA; Los Angeles, CA; Houston, TX.

Does Taiwan have passport?
The Republic of China Passport (Chinese: 中華民國護照; pinyin: Zhōnghuá Mínguó hùzhào) is the passport issued to nationals of the Republic of China (ROC), commonly known as Taiwan. The ROC passport is also generally referred to as a Taiwan passport.

How good is a Chinese passport?
As of August 2021, Chinese citizens had visa-free or visa on arrival access to 78 countries and territories, ranking the Chinese passport 72nd in terms of travel freedom according to the Henley Passport Index.
How do I renew my Hong Kong passport in the USA?
You can apply by post As in the United States and many other countries, using the post is one of the fastest, easiest and most popular ways to renew a passport. Mail in your completed Form ID 841 along with high-quality photocopies of your HKIC and your about-to-expire passport.
